A 85 kVA integrated on-board charger was developed to allow an electric bus to be charged on an inexpensive three-phase 400V/50 Hz socket. The aim of the project is to reduce significantly the global cost of electric buses and their charging infrastructure. That is why the charger uses the traction inverter components (IGBT, control, air cooling). The power factor is kept near 1. Low frequency electromagnetic compatibility emission are avoided by a Pulse Width Modulation control which limits the input current harmonics values. The paper presents the power converter structure, its control and the test results as input current waveforms.
